Member List

CPP API: Member List
mio::CustomIndexArray< Typ, Tags >::Slice< Tag, iter_type >::Iterator< T > Member List

This is the complete list of members for mio::CustomIndexArray< Typ, Tags >::Slice< Tag, iter_type >::Iterator< T >, including all inherited members.

data_beginmio::CustomIndexArray< Typ, Tags >::Slice< Tag, iter_type >::Iterator< T >private
dimio::CustomIndexArray< Typ, Tags >::Slice< Tag, iter_type >::Iterator< T >private
difference_type typedefmio::CustomIndexArray< Typ, Tags >::Slice< Tag, iter_type >::Iterator< T >
drmio::CustomIndexArray< Typ, Tags >::Slice< Tag, iter_type >::Iterator< T >private
inner_offsetmio::CustomIndexArray< Typ, Tags >::Slice< Tag, iter_type >::Iterator< T >private
Iterator(iter_type begin_, size_t di_, size_t dr_, Seq< size_t > const &seq_, difference_type offset=0)mio::CustomIndexArray< Typ, Tags >::Slice< Tag, iter_type >::Iterator< T >inline
iterator_category typedefmio::CustomIndexArray< Typ, Tags >::Slice< Tag, iter_type >::Iterator< T >
operator!=(const Iterator &a, const Iterator &b)mio::CustomIndexArray< Typ, Tags >::Slice< Tag, iter_type >::Iterator< T >friend
operator*()mio::CustomIndexArray< Typ, Tags >::Slice< Tag, iter_type >::Iterator< T >inline
operator*() constmio::CustomIndexArray< Typ, Tags >::Slice< Tag, iter_type >::Iterator< T >inline
operator+(const int &rhs) constmio::CustomIndexArray< Typ, Tags >::Slice< Tag, iter_type >::Iterator< T >inline
operator++()mio::CustomIndexArray< Typ, Tags >::Slice< Tag, iter_type >::Iterator< T >inline
operator++(int)mio::CustomIndexArray< Typ, Tags >::Slice< Tag, iter_type >::Iterator< T >inline
operator+=(const int &rhs)mio::CustomIndexArray< Typ, Tags >::Slice< Tag, iter_type >::Iterator< T >inline
operator-(const int &rhs) constmio::CustomIndexArray< Typ, Tags >::Slice< Tag, iter_type >::Iterator< T >inline
operator--()mio::CustomIndexArray< Typ, Tags >::Slice< Tag, iter_type >::Iterator< T >inline
operator--(int)mio::CustomIndexArray< Typ, Tags >::Slice< Tag, iter_type >::Iterator< T >inline
operator-=(const int &rhs)mio::CustomIndexArray< Typ, Tags >::Slice< Tag, iter_type >::Iterator< T >inline
operator->()mio::CustomIndexArray< Typ, Tags >::Slice< Tag, iter_type >::Iterator< T >inline
operator<(const Iterator &a, const Iterator &b)mio::CustomIndexArray< Typ, Tags >::Slice< Tag, iter_type >::Iterator< T >friend
operator<=(const Iterator &a, const Iterator &b)mio::CustomIndexArray< Typ, Tags >::Slice< Tag, iter_type >::Iterator< T >friend
operator=(size_t rhs)mio::CustomIndexArray< Typ, Tags >::Slice< Tag, iter_type >::Iterator< T >inline
operator=(const Iterator &rhs)mio::CustomIndexArray< Typ, Tags >::Slice< Tag, iter_type >::Iterator< T >inline
operator==(const Iterator &a, const Iterator &b)mio::CustomIndexArray< Typ, Tags >::Slice< Tag, iter_type >::Iterator< T >friend
operator>(const Iterator &a, const Iterator &b)mio::CustomIndexArray< Typ, Tags >::Slice< Tag, iter_type >::Iterator< T >friend
operator>=(const Iterator &a, const Iterator &b)mio::CustomIndexArray< Typ, Tags >::Slice< Tag, iter_type >::Iterator< T >friend
operator[](const difference_type &rhs)mio::CustomIndexArray< Typ, Tags >::Slice< Tag, iter_type >::Iterator< T >inline
operator[](const difference_type &rhs) constmio::CustomIndexArray< Typ, Tags >::Slice< Tag, iter_type >::Iterator< T >inline
outer_offset(difference_type const &inner) constmio::CustomIndexArray< Typ, Tags >::Slice< Tag, iter_type >::Iterator< T >inlineprivate
pointer typedefmio::CustomIndexArray< Typ, Tags >::Slice< Tag, iter_type >::Iterator< T >
reference typedefmio::CustomIndexArray< Typ, Tags >::Slice< Tag, iter_type >::Iterator< T >
seqmio::CustomIndexArray< Typ, Tags >::Slice< Tag, iter_type >::Iterator< T >private
value_type typedefmio::CustomIndexArray< Typ, Tags >::Slice< Tag, iter_type >::Iterator< T >